Demographics
Sumter County's explosive population growth — driven almost entirely by The Villages master-planned retirement community — has made it one of the fastest-growing counties in the U.S., with a distinctly older, white electorate that has produced some of Florida's widest presidential margins.
The Republican margin here reached fifty-four points in 1972. Between 2020 and 2024 the county moved one point toward the Republican candidate; the 2024 margin was thirty-eight points.
A population of 143,408, a 85% non-Hispanic-white share, and a median household income of $76,508 describe the county. The county's voting pattern over the last decade is most similar to that of Polk County and La Paz County.
